Core Components of a Battery Pack
A pack battery isn't just a cluster of cells—it's a meticulously engineered system. Let's look at its key elements:
- Battery Cells: The building blocks, often using lithium-ion or solid-state chemistry.
- Battery Management System (BMS): Acts as the "brain," monitoring temperature and voltage.
- Thermal Regulation: Prevents overheating with liquid cooling or air vents.
- Interconnectors: Ensure seamless energy flow between cells.

Real-World Applications
From powering Tesla's Model 3 to storing excess solar energy in residential setups, pack batteries are everywhere. For instance, the Hornsdale Power Reserve in Australia—a 150MW battery farm—uses pack technology to stabilize the grid and prevent blackouts.

Why Thermal Management Matters
Did you know poor thermal design can slash a battery's lifespan by 40%? Modern systems use phase-change materials or liquid cooling to maintain optimal 20-35°C operating ranges.
